Summary
Luke is cranked up after hosting a morning radio show and drinking 100 cups of coffee. Andrew is sluggish after staying up all night watching special episodes of Murder, She Wrote. So, yeah. Things get sloppy. They discuss the official end of the VCR, the resurgence of classic North Korean spycraft, and whether or not they know what words mean.
